Originally Posted by Porkie


someone told me all the technical details of what was done but told me not to post.

It wasn't that much actually!
I'm guessing they either waterproofed all the door seals and vents etc to stop it flooding then towed it in, or waterproofed as above then ducted the air intake through the bulkhead into the cabin and drove it under its own power.

Plus they probably weighted it up a bit so it didn't float and roll over in the waves.
